Why ƒ/Calc?

The equations ƒ/Calc uses aren’t secret or difficult. You handled more difficult equations in high school math class, and this manual gives you all the equations.

You may therefore be asking, why use ƒ/Calc if you can do without? Simply, because crunching the numbers by hand is tedious and slow compared to using ƒ/Calc. The faster you can work through a problem, the quicker you can get back to shooting. Or, you can learn several things in the same amount of time as it would have taken you to crunch the numbers for a single problem by hand.

ƒ/Calc also takes into account unit conversions and provides advice on calculated results based on its knowledge of lenses, helping you to avoid mistakes.
